Tu O Nadie: The English (second) version

 



The second version of Tu O Nadie,  released in 1995 is  Acapulco Bay;  a joint venture of Televista and Fox TV. The story is also  set in Acapulco but with both American and Hispanic  actors and actresses and the names anglicized versions of the Spanish names of the main characters. 


Here, Antonio is Tony Stockdale (Anthony Newman), Raquel is Rachel Swanson Stockdale (Raquel Gardner- she’s half Brazilian), and Maximilian Albeniz is Max Hauser (Ash Adams but credited as "Jason Adams" at the time). 


             DIFFERENCES



- The false wedding between Max and Rachel was conducted by a clerk, not in Guadalajara but San Francisco.





-Rachel’s father, Peter Swanson,  walked with a cane.






 Tony and Rachel  nearly made love for the first time, on tne night of their first date. 




- The night Tony confronted Rachel to tell him the truth; he had to stop her from committing suicide first- she tried to drown herself in the ocean.



- Tony and Rachel didn’t go out on the yacht, they had a picnic on the beach and went skinny dipping (and then some!)


- When Tony and Rachel had their terrible fight; Rachel not only left the money, plane tickets and a letter but also her diamond wedding ring. 

-Tony’s personal assistant  Charles is old enough to be his father.





-Tony and Rachel’s daughter, was shown sleeping in an incubator.

- Max was shot dead, but NOT by Tony.
